Title
Effect of DC electric field on the dispersive characteristics of acoustic waves in piezoelectric layered structure

Abstract
Boundary conditions for a layered piezoelectric structure under the influence of a uniform dc electric field have been obtained. Dispersive dependences and anisotropy of phase velocities, electromechanical coupling coefficients, power flow angle, and controlling coefficients of dc electric field influence as a functions of h×f product for the Rayleigh and Love modes in bismuth germanium oxide/fused silica and langasite/fused silica layered structures have been calculated.
